在现代企业网络架构中,虚拟专用网络(VPN)已成为远程办公、跨地域数据传输和安全访问的核心技术,当用户报告“VPN网络状态异常”时,往往意味着连接中断、延迟高、无法访问内网资源等问题,这不仅影响工作效率,还可能暴露安全风险,作为网络工程师,我们需要快速定位问题根源并实施有效修复,本文将从常见原因、诊断流程到解决方案进行系统性分析。

明确“VPN网络状态异常”的定义至关重要,它可能表现为:客户端无法建立连接、连接后频繁断开、内网访问超时、证书验证失败、或带宽严重受限等,这类问题通常由以下几类因素引发:

  1. 网络连通性问题
    检查本地网络是否正常,例如ping公网IP地址是否通畅,DNS解析是否成功,若本地网络不稳定(如Wi-Fi信号弱或路由器故障),则会影响VPN隧道建立,建议使用tracert命令追踪路径,确认是否存在中间节点丢包。

  2. 防火墙或安全策略限制
    企业级防火墙(如Cisco ASA、FortiGate)或云服务商的安全组规则可能阻止UDP/TCP端口(如IKE端口500、ESP协议4500)的通信,需检查策略配置,确保允许VPN流量通过,部分公司启用IPS/IDS设备时,可能误判加密流量为攻击行为而阻断。

  3. 认证或证书问题
    若使用证书认证(如EAP-TLS),需验证客户端证书是否过期、CA根证书是否信任,若采用用户名密码方式,则需排除账号锁定或密码错误导致的失败,建议在日志中查看认证阶段的具体错误代码(如“Invalid credentials”或“Certificate expired”)。

  4. 服务器端负载过高或配置错误
    远程VPN网关(如Windows Server RRAS、OpenVPN服务)若CPU占用率持续超过80%,可能导致响应缓慢,配置文件中的MTU设置不当(如过大)会引起分片丢包,可通过netstat -an | findstr :1723(PPTP)或ss -tulnp | grep openvpn(OpenVPN)查看监听状态。

  5. 客户端软件兼容性问题
    老旧版本的VPN客户端可能存在漏洞或协议不匹配(如IKEv1 vs IKEv2),建议升级至最新版本,并尝试更换不同协议测试(如从PPTP切换到L2TP/IPSec或WireGuard)。

诊断步骤应遵循“由简到繁”原则:

  • 第一步:重启客户端与本地路由器,排除临时故障;
  • 第二步:使用ipconfig /release && ipconfig /renew释放并刷新IP地址;
  • 第三步:检查服务器日志(如Windows事件查看器或Linux syslog),定位具体错误;
  • 第四步:启用抓包工具(Wireshark)捕获握手过程,分析是否有SYN/ACK丢失或密钥协商失败;
  • 第五步:联系ISP或云厂商,确认是否存在线路抖动或DDoS防护触发。

解决方案因场景而异,若为网络层问题,可调整QoS策略优先保障VPN流量;若为认证失败,则重新生成证书或重置用户权限;若为服务器性能瓶颈,建议扩容资源或启用负载均衡,长期来看,推荐部署SD-WAN替代传统VPN,实现智能路径选择和自动故障切换。

处理VPN异常需结合工具、日志与网络拓扑综合判断,作为网络工程师,不仅要解决当前问题,更要建立监控机制(如Zabbix告警)预防未来风险,确保业务连续性和数据安全性。

VPN网络状态异常排查与解决方案详解  第1张

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速